ST Engineering iDirect and Black Cat Systems Launch Satcom Lab for ADF

ST Engineering iDirect and Australia’s Black Cat Systems have expanded their long-standing partnership to create an Advanced Satcom Technology Demonstration Lab, showcasing next-generation, multi-orbit military satellite communications for the Australian Defence Force (ADF).

At the center of the lab is iDirect’s new 450 Software Defined Modem (450SDM), a compact, multi-waveform, multi-orbit satcom modem supporting HEO, GEO, MEO, and LEO networks on a single platform. Designed for mission-critical operations, the 450SDM integrates high-rate mobility, TRANSEC and FIPS 140-3 Level 3 security, and CSIR™ interference mitigation, all while reducing size, weight and power by 30%.

Black Cat Systems has procured additional Evolution Defense hubs and 9-Series modems, and will use the lab to demonstrate secure, resilient satcom capabilities purpose-built for ADF requirements. Paired with the Evolution Defense 4.6 platform, the system enables crypto-agile, interference-resilient, and highly mobile connectivity across diverse operational environments.
